Where are We Staying?

We'll stay at a working farm refered to as an agriturismo centrally located in the heart of Tuscany near San Quirico in the Val d'Orcia. 

The farm land surrounding our accommodations is quite beautiful and affords many opportunities for photography without ever leaving the premises!


Each day we'll have excursions into the countryside and to the neighboring villages such as Montepulciano, Siena, Pienza, Cortona, and more.

Itinerary

Tuscany 2025!
Traditional, Infrared, and iPhone Photography

The itinerary for our trip is fluid and will depend on weather, community events, and seasonal crops. 


Each day we will have the opportunity to photograph on the beautiful grounds of our Agritourismo, a remote working farm in the heart of Val d'Orcia. 


Throughout the week we'll venture out for sunrises, country landscapes, and exploration of cities including Cortona, Monticchello, Pienza, and Sienna. We'll visit castles in the region and photograph extraordinary landscape scenes along Asciano Ridge and outside Pienza where The Gladiator, was filmed. 


Learning occurs each day in the field and at informal gatherings during mealtime and during breaks at our agritourismo. 

Your Organizer


RD
Rad Drew Photography, LLC
Teacher, photographer, and tour leader, Rad A. Drew, creates with the iPhone, mirrorless, and infrared cameras. A frequent contributor to PSA Journal, TheAppWhisperer, and PhotoPxl.com, Rad was listed in PSA’s Who’s Who in Photography 2018. His creative images have been recognized internationally and exhibited in galleries around the world including SOHO Gallery in NYC, and Obscura Gallery in Melbourne. He is best known for his How I Did It!™ tutorials, his iPhone expertise, and his exploration of infrared photography using the iPhone!
